  • Abstract
    This paper describes a comparison of the effects of gamma radiation from spent nuclear fuel elements and cobalt-60 isotope sources on electronic components. The types of component assessed, details of the radiation testing and the results obtained are covered in depth. The conclusion is reached that the magnitude of any discrepancies observed in the type or degree of radiation effect is small when compared with the batch-to-batch variation between components and the differences resulting from temperature changes
